Koh Samui (Island of Smiles), third largest of the islands in the Gulf of Thailand, is known for its palm-fringed beaches circling coconut groves and dense, mountainous rainforest. Must visit places are the 12m-tall golden Big Buddha statue at Wat Phra Yai temple, Ang Thong National Marine Park. Besides, you may visit island Koh Phangan – undoubtedly the party capital of Thailand. The full moon parties on the beach are world famous
Krabi Town has a slogan of “Lovely Town, Lively People”, and once you’re there, you can see why. Especially toward the evening, you’ll find lots of outdoor eating places by the river, frying up fresh noodles and seafood to lots of hungry locals and tourists.
Come to Bangkok and experience Thailand’s culture among the hundreds of glittering Buddhist temples, magnificent palaces, classical dance extravaganzas, numerous shopping centres and Asia’s largest outdoor week-end market – Chatuchak. In addition, enjoy luxurious cruises along the timeless canals and the Chao Phraya, ‘River of Kings’ winding through the city.
